No tubes, faster healing? new trial tests lighter anesthesia for lung surgery
Symptom relief Not yet recruitingThis study compares a 'tubeless' approach to standard care for people having minimally invasive surgery to remove small lung nodules. Can a See-Through tube make lung surgery safer?
Knowledge-focused Not yet recruitingThis study compares a new visual double-lumen tube to a standard tube for lung surgery.
